The Joint Light Tactical Vehicle (JLTV) is designed with advanced capabilities to navigate various terrains and conditions. A vehicle's ability to negotiate grades and slopes is critical for operational effectiveness, especially in military applications where maneuverability is essential.

The correct choice indicates that the JLTV can successfully negotiate a slope of 40% and a grade of 60%. This capability is a result of the JLTV's robust design, which includes a powerful engine, advanced suspension system, and superior traction control. These features allow the vehicle to maintain stability and control while traversing steep inclines or declines, which can be encountered in a wide range of environments.

Understanding these specifications helps users appreciate the vehicle’s operational limits and its suitability for different missions, ensuring that it can effectively support troops in diverse and challenging terrains.
